The Secret to Perfecting This Dish

Achieving optimal results for your HIGH PROTEIN Beef Beef Pepperoni Pizza Rolls hinges on efficient sequencing. Begin by pre-cooking your seasoned beef and draining excess fat thoroughly to prevent soggy rolls. Next, assemble the filling, ensuring cheese and beef pepperoni are evenly distributed. Roll and seal each portion tightly to contain the delicious contents. Finally, bake them on a preheated sheet to guarantee a uniformly golden, crispy crust and perfectly melted interior.

Add Your Personal Touch

Personalize your HIGH PROTEIN Beef Beef Pepperoni Pizza Rolls with various additions. Swap mozzarella for a blend of provolone and Monterey Jack for a sharper flavor profile. Incorporate finely diced bell peppers or mushrooms into the beef mixture for added nutrients. A pinch of smoked paprika or a dash of onion powder can elevate the seasoning, while a sprinkle of red pepper flakes offers a welcome kick.

Storing & Reheating for Best Quality

Store leftover HIGH PROTEIN Beef Beef Pepperoni Pizza Rolls in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. For longer storage, freeze cooled rolls on a baking sheet before transferring them to a freezer bag for up to two months. Reheat frozen rolls in a preheated oven at 375°F (190°C) for 15-20 minutes, or until heated through and crispy, for best texture.

Expert Advice

  • Ensure each pizza roll is securely sealed after filling to prevent any leakage of cheese or beef during the baking process.
  • Avoid overfilling the rolls; a balanced amount of high-protein beef, beef pepperoni, and cheese ensures even cooking and structural integrity.
  • For an extra crispy base, preheat your baking sheet in the oven before placing the pizza rolls directly onto the hot surface.

Craving cheesy, savory HIGH PROTEIN Beef Turkey Pepperoni Pizza Rolls? Browned lean beef, zesty sauce, and mozzarella rolled in protein wraps create a quick, satisfying meal.

  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b (450g) Lean Ground Beef (90% lean or higher)
  • 1/2 cup (120g) Beef Beef Pepperoni, finely diced
  • 1 cup (112g) Part-Skim Mozzarella Cheese, shredded
  • 1/2 cup (120ml) Low-Sugar Pizza Sauce
  • 8–10 Large Protein Tortillas or Low-Carb Wraps
  • 1 large Egg, whisked
  • 1 tsp Italian Seasoning
  • 1/2 tsp Garlic Powder

Instructions

  1. Step 1: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). In a large skillet, brown the lean ground beef over medium heat until fully cooked. Drain any excess fat. Add the finely diced beef beef pepperoni, pizza sauce, shredded mozzarella cheese, Italian seasoning, and garlic powder to the skillet. Stir well to combine and cook for 2-3 minutes until the cheese begins to melt and the mixture is heated through.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  2. Step 2: Lay out one protein tortilla or low-carb wrap on a clean surface. Spoon about 2-3 tablespoons of the beef and beef pepperoni filling in a line across the center of the tortilla, leaving about an inch of space from each edge.
  3. Step 3: Fold in the sides of the tortilla over the filling. Then, starting from one end, tightly roll the tortilla up, creating a log. Brush a small amount of the whisked egg onto the final seam to seal the roll securely. Repeat with the remaining tortillas and filling.
  4. Step 4: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Using a sharp knife, cut each rolled tortilla log into 1-inch (2.5 cm) thick individual pizza rolls. Arrange the cut rolls on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they are not touching.
  5. Step 5: Brush the tops and sides of each pizza roll with the remaining whisked egg.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the rolls are golden brown and the filling is hot and bubbling. Remove from the oven and let cool for a few minutes before serving.

Notes

  • For easy future snacks, store cooled rolls in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days, or freeze them in a single layer on a baking sheet before transferring to a freezer bag for up to a month.
  • To bring back that fresh-baked crunch, reheat chilled rolls in an air fryer at 350°F (175°C) for 5-7 minutes, or in an oven at 375°F (190°C) for 8-12 minutes, until heated through and golden.
  • These savory rolls are fantastic on their own, but truly shine when paired with your favorite low-sugar marinara for dipping or a fresh side salad for a balanced, satisfying meal.
  • Achieving perfectly sealed and crispy rolls hinges on two things: ensure your beef and beef pepperoni filling has cooled slightly before rolling, and make sure to roll the tortillas tightly, using the egg wash generously on the seam for a secure closure.
